**Digest Scheduling Overview**

The Mailloom digest scheduler batches outbound summaries into hourly windows, keyed by recipient timezone. Jobs are enqueued by the Cadencer service and signed with a rotating internal token; no customer credentials are stored in the queue payload. Retries cap at three attempts with exponential backoff, after which the batch is quarantined for manual review. Full data-flow diagrams are in the Mailloom design folder. For audit artifacts or token rotation logs, email the platform owners below.

escalation mailbox, fafof-bahip: tamael@ordincorp.test

# Capacity Decision — Thornquay Plant (Managers Only)

Board summary. Thornquay runs at 94% utilisation; the Selda line is the bottleneck. Options assessed: third shift, outsourcing to Kelverton Works, or a second line. Recommendation: second line, 14-month payback, funded from retained earnings. Third shift rejected on quality grounds; outsourcing rejected on margin. Decision required at the next board sitting. Full financials in the appendix. The confidential planning context is appended below.

management briefing: Headcount on the Quenael team goes from 9 to 80 by the end of July. Gross margin on Quenael came in at 15 percent against a plan of 20 percent.

Welcome to the Sievewright validator plugin system! Each validator ships as a small plugin bundle that gets loaded at release time. As release manager, your main job is to vet the bundle manifest, bump the plugin registry version, and tag the release. Don't skip the manifest check — unsigned plugins get rejected by the loader. When you're ready to cut the release, sign the bundle with the key below:

rollout seal: bky4_x7Gc

## Timeline — 14:22

Okay, so the Thimbleround image slimming job finally landed, but it stripped the locale data the worker needs, and pods started crash-looping in the Dunmore cluster. Rolled back to the previous fat image and things settled within four minutes. If you're on call and see this again, just pin the pre-slim tag. The offending build's token is right below.

pipeline stamp: htk9_ce63042d9